Sharaabi (1984) Spoiler-Free Summary – What It's About

Release, runtime and language
1984 · 180 mins · Hindi
Directed by
Prakash Mehra
Starring
Amitabh Bachchan, Dinesh Hingoo, Ranjeet Bedi, Jaya Prada, Om Prakash, A.K. Hangal

Vicky Kapoor, billionaire Amarnath’s only son, is a kind‑hearted alcoholic neglected by his cold father. Amarnath wants a rich marriage, but Vicky loves Meena, the blind man’s daughter. When Amarnath throws Vicky out and makes him sign waivers, he must survive on his own, aided by surrogate father Munshi Phoolchand (Om Prakash) and the supportive Jaya Pradha.

What Is Sharaabi About? (No Spoilers)

The plot of Sharaabi (1984) without spoilers: what it is about, who it follows and where it takes place, told without the twists or the ending. Enough to decide whether it is your next watch, not enough to ruin it.

In the glittering world of corporate moguls, a young heir named Vicky Kapoor drifts between privilege and longing. The son of the powerful and emotionally distant billionaire Amarnath, Vicky finds solace in drink, a habit born from the cold silence of a father more concerned with boardrooms than bedtime stories. The opulent mansions and high‑society gatherings frame his daily life, yet an undercurrent of yearning pulls him toward something far simpler—a love that blossoms beyond wealth and expectation.

Across the bustling streets, Meena moves with the grace of a dancer and the strength of someone raised by a blind father who taught her to see with her heart. Her modest background and unpretentious spirit stand in stark contrast to Vicky’s lavish upbringing, setting the stage for a romance that challenges family tradition and societal pressure. While Amarnath envisions a marriage that would cement his empire’s status, Vicky’s affection for Meena threatens to upend those calculated plans, hinting at a clash between duty and desire.

Amid the tension, a loyal caretaker named Munshi Phoolchand serves as the steady anchor Vicky’s life desperately needs, offering guidance that no amount of money can buy. Alongside him, Jaya Pradha provides a compassionate presence that further softens the harsh edges of Vicky’s world. Together they form an unlikely support network, suggesting that true wealth may be measured not by assets but by the bonds forged in honesty and empathy. The film’s tone sways between heartfelt melodrama and bright, musical interludes, inviting viewers to wonder whether love and loyalty can triumph over the rigid expectations of a privileged dynasty.
